TapHouse Kitchen expands in the New Year with a new and second location Friday, January 4th, at 3131 E Shea Boulevard in Phoenix. The second location promises to deliver delicious food and drink in a casually sophisticated atmosphere to the bustling “North 32nd” neighborhood of North Central Phoenix. While “osteria” means a simple or inexpensive Italian restaurant, we doubt that Fellow Osteria will be even close to simple. Fellow Osteria is situated inside a stylish, yet welcoming, indoor/outdoor space at SkySong. The restaurant hopes to bring an authentic Italian osteria menu and vibe to the heart of south Scottsdale.
